TESCO’s New Portable Meter Testing Platform

Model 6440 three-phase voltage synthesizer for revenue meter commissioning, site verification, and field diagnostics

(TESCO: Bristol, PA) -- As electric utilities continue modernizing the grid with advanced metering infrastructure (AMI), distributed energy resources (DERs), electric vehicle charging infrastructure, and increasingly sophisticated distribution systems, field technicians require testing equipment that is as adaptable as the systems they maintain. Responding to that need, The Eastern Specialty Co. (TESCO) announces the Model 6440 three-phase voltage synthesizer, its newest expansion of the TESCO portable meter testing platform.

The portable meter testing platform design provides utilities with a flexible, modular approach to field testing. Anchored by the proven TESCO 6330 meter site analyzer, and now expanded with the Model 6440 three-phase voltage synthesizer, the platform delivers laboratory-grade testing capabilities in a portable, field-ready solution. By separating voltage generation from measurement and analysis, utilities can configure the right combination of instruments for each application without the size, weight, or complexity of traditional integrated testing systems.
